Output 17ff3bf6e26473823b01df08f48c977fcaeb520fab8f30fe5a6904a98508aa2b:1

value
342936
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c4d072351b8516caad8c30b201fdf90ff4aaadda OP_EQUALVERIFY OP_CHECKSIG
address
1Jwf9gykZnVoKHWVY6p7ALwxmgcU7zMDuA
transaction
17ff3bf6e26473823b01df08f48c977fcaeb520fab8f30fe5a6904a98508aa2b
confirmations
508900
spent
true